Introducing Einar Gausel


4 May 2000

 

The MSO's Chess Correspondent

Einar Gausel
(Born 1963)

Lived in Boston 1966-69 and Montreal 1969-75. Moved back to Norway in 1975 and has been living in Oslo ever since.

Studied computing, marketing, and accounting (his only degree is in marketing), before he decided he didn't really want to work for a living. "I was a professional chess player for about five years. Then I discovered I could make more money writing about the game than actually playing it." Has a daily column in Norway's 2nd largest tabloid, Dagbladet, and a weekly column in Norway's largest men's magazine (No, not that kind of magazine), Vi Menn.

Was already semi-retired from chess when he made his 3rd and final grandmaster norm in 1995.

2 times Norwegian champion. 5 times Norwegian blitz champion.

Engaged - soon to be married. One daughter.

Enjoys following other Mindsports, but the only one he's actually able to play with some degree of skill (besides chess) is Poker.

Also likes playing "Pub Sports" - pool and darts.
